Output 6408997000ca94e213d7af04400a6c9514aa3b4b4fcce6ea6b913ab9e20a9799:3

value
156886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81dee397c1bf8af6aba02cff43e1f8fb6e07e401 OP_EQUAL
address
3DXi6tfD2GbVaoy4y8ZhaRbfEzkxwWPe7X
transaction
6408997000ca94e213d7af04400a6c9514aa3b4b4fcce6ea6b913ab9e20a9799
confirmations
191042
spent
true